How To Care For and Maintain Your Simulated Fence
Simulated Fence - General Care
- Rinse off debris – A simple spray with your garden hose removes grass clippings, dirt and fertilizer
chemicals and helps keep your fence looking like new. - Avoid Excess Stress – Keep gates secured when not in use, and discourage children from swinging on them,
to avoid excess wear on the hinges. Avoid stacking materials against your fence. - Annual check-up – Each Spring, adjust gates to ensure they’re level and latch securely. Oil hinges and
check that screws are tight. If needed, re-tamp and realign any loose fence posts.
Simulated Fence Cleaning
- Light cleaning – Mild soap and water take care of most everyday dirt.
- Minor stains – Use a non-abrasive liquid cleaner.
- Stubborn stains – Try one of the following: Simple Green®, Mr. Clean® Magic Eraser, Mineral Spirits, Trichloroethylene, CLR® or vinegar. Always follow the manufacturer’s directions.
Note: Avoid using Goof Off®, as it may damage the finish.

What is the warranty coverage for Allegheny/Sherwood fencing?
These fences come with a lifetime limited warranty against manufacturing defects such as peeling, flaking, blistering and corroding.

How does Allegheny/Sherwood fencing withstand UV exposure and fading over time?
Simulated Fencing fencing from Bufftech is engineered to withstand UV exposure and resist fading over time due to its proprietary blend of polyethylene plastic and recycled wood fibers. The materials used are formulated to be UV-stabilized, ensuring long-lasting color retention and durability even in harsh sunlight conditions.

What is Allegheny/Sherwood fencing made of?
Allegheny/Sherwood fencing is made of a proprietary blend of polyethylene plastic and recycled wood fibers, providing durability, low maintenance, and the appearance of natural stone and wood.
